Las Vegas Papers Win JOA Approval: U.S. Atty. Gen. Dick Thornburgh approved a plan to merge the business operations of the Las Vegas Sun and the Las Vegas Review-Journal. Under the joint operating arrangement, the newspapers will maintain separate editorial and reporting staffs. There is no change in ownership involved, only a merging of advertising, printing and circulation departments. The Sun, which has been a morning paper, will become an afternoon paper publishing on weekdays, and the Review-Journal will publish only in the morning. It has been publishing an afternoon edition. A single edition with the names of both papers would be published on Saturdays and Sundays.
